      Meaning of the first name
      Erna

      Origin 
      English

      Meaning 
      Earnest

      Variations 
      Verna, Bernal, Hernan

      *Some content has been generated by an artificial intelligence language model, in combination with data sourced from Ancestry records and provided by BabyNames.com.
      The first name Erna traces its origins back to the English language and is derived from the word earnest. The name Earnest itself has deep historical roots and has been used as a given name since medieval times. Its usage can be attributed to the Old English word earnest, which means serious or sincere. The name Erna reflects these aspects of seriousness and sincerity in its meaning, making it an enduring choice for parents seeking a name with a strong and trustworthy connotation.

      Throughout history, the name Erna has appeared across various cultures and regions, although it remains most commonly associated with English-speaking populations. In medieval Europe, the name Earnest was often given to individuals who displayed a serious or dutiful nature, reflecting the qualities associated with the name's meaning. In modern times, Erna continues to be used as a first name, albeit less frequently. Despite its declining popularity, the name still bears significance for those who appreciate its historical roots and its representation of earnestness and sincerity.

      In summary, the name Erna originates from English, specifically from the word earnest, and has been used as a given name since medieval times. Its usage reflects the qualities of seriousness and sincerity throughout history. Although its popularity has waned in modern times, Erna remains a meaningful choice for those who value its historical origins and the inherent qualities it represents.
      Based on our records...
      This is the most common surname, spouse name and child name associated with Erna.
      Schmidt

      is the most common surname for Erna.

      Karl

      is the most common spouse name for Erna.

      Erna

      is the most common child name for Erna.
